🎉 Welcome to Day 20 of the '30 Days of JavaScript Coding' Challenge!
In this video, we’re breaking down the essential concept of Event Propagation in JavaScript, focusing on Bubbling and Capturing. Understanding how events flow through the DOM is key to writing robust and efficient event-handling code. 🌐
Here’s what you’ll learn today:
✅ What is event propagation, and why does it matter? 🤔
✅ How event bubbling works – from child to parent 🔝
✅ What is event capturing, and how it flows from parent to child 🔽
✅ The difference between bubbling and capturing 🔍
✅ How to control propagation using `stopPropagation()` 🛑
✅ Adding event listeners with the capture phase using `{ capture: true }` 🖱️
✅ Practical examples to handle complex nested event scenarios 💻
✅ Best practices for managing event propagation in your projects 🚀
🔥 By the end of this video, you’ll master event bubbling and capturing, empowering you to handle events more effectively in JavaScript.
👨💻 Code along with me as we explore these concepts step by step and implement them with hands-on examples!
💬 Got questions or need further examples? Drop them in the comments, and I’ll be happy to help.
📅 Stay tuned for Day 21 – Subscribe and hit the bell icon 🔔 to continue this exciting JavaScript journey with me. 🚀
#30DaysOfJavaScript #LearnJavaScript #JavaScriptChallenge #BubblingAndCapturing #EventPropagation #CodeWithAswin #CodingJourney